Grungy Film Festival Weekend at Kino Cinemas | 05/10/2012

For the first time in 2012, the Greek Film Festival in Melbourne is screening a selection of its most cutting-edge dramas at Kino Cinemas on Saturday 27 and Sunday 28 October.

Three friends roam the streets of Exarcheia on a hot August night in Jerks (dir. Stelios Kammitsis), while Boy Eating the Bird's Food (dir. Ektoras Lygizos) explores starvation, alienation and de-humanisation on the streets of austerity-dominated Athens. Four couples and four pregnancies meet one inextricably violent end in The City of Children (dir. Yorgos Gikapeppas), and exclusion, violence and psychological cannibalism come to a head in Tungsten (dir. Giorgos Georgopoulos).
